What GamStop Actually Does

GamStop is a UK self-exclusion programme. You pick a time period, sign up, and participating UK-licensed operators lock you out of their sites for the duration. It works as designed – while it’s active, you’re blocked. But note the word “participating.” International casinos licensed outside the UK sit completely outside this system, which is exactly why they’ve become so popular with players who want back in, or who simply never wanted the restriction in the first place.
